attempt to concatenate global 'donate' (a nil value)

SURVERS

Активный
Автор темы
139
32
Версия MoonLoader
Другое
Как исправить эту долбаунную ошибку, position.lua:491: attempt to concatenate global 'donate' (a nil value)
Заранее спасибочки :3
Lua:
    if title:find('Основная статистика') then
        level = getBotScore()
        money = getBotMoney()
        bank = text:match('{FFFFFF}Деньги в банке: {B83434}%[%$(%d+)%]')
        deposit = text:match('{FFFFFF}Деньги на депозите: {B83434}%[%$(%d+)%]')
        donate = text:match('Текущее состояние счета:         (%d+) az coins')
        print(donate)
    end
UPD: Проблему решил вот таким регулярным выражением: local donate = "(%d+) AZ%-Coins"
 
Последнее редактирование:

chromiusj

Известный
Модератор
5,656
3,959
ну значит регулярка не подходит под твою строку,попробуй вместо большого пробела сделать так

Lua:
local text = 'a long                 space is 15'
--before
variable = text:match("a long                 space is (%d+)")
--after
variable = text:match("a long%s+space is (%d+)")